Stopping a print request

You can stop a print request either from the MFP control panel or from your software application. To
stop a print request from a computer on a network, see the online Help for the specific network software.

NOTE

It may take some time for all printing to clear after you have canceled a print job.

To stop the current print job from the MFP control panel

1.

Press

Stop

on the MFP control panel.

2.

To resume the print job, press

Start

.

Pressing

Stop

does not affect subsequent print jobs that are stored in the MFP buffer.

To stop the current print job from a software application

A dialog box will appear briefly on the control panel display, giving you the option to cancel the print job.

If several requests have been sent to the MFP through an application, the print jobs might be waiting in
a print queue (for example, in Windows Print Manager). See the application documentation for specific
instructions on canceling a print request from the computer.

If a print job is waiting in a print queue (computer memory) or print spooler (Windows 98, 2000, XP, or
Me), delete the print job there.

For Windows 98, 2000, XP, or Me, go to Start, Settings, and then Printers. Double-click the HP Color
LaserJet 4730mfp
icon to open the print spooler. Select the print job you want to cancel, and then press

Delete

. If the print job is not cancelled, you might need to shut down and restart the computer.
